Abstract
A display device having a built-in touchscreen and a driving chip, a circuit film, and a chip-on-film (COF) type driving circuit included in the display device. The COF type driving circuit performs data driving and touch driving in a combined manner. A source driving circuit outputs image data voltages through data channels. At least one touch driving circuit outputs touch driving signals through touch channels. The source driving circuit and the at least one touch driving circuit are mounted on an integrated circuit film. Data channel lines electrically connected to the data channels and touch channel lines electrically connected to the touch channels are disposed on the integrated circuit film. The noise avoidance line disposed on the integrated circuit film is located outward of an at least one outermost touch channel line.
